網站首頁 工作範例 辦公範例 個人範例 黨團範例 簡歷範例 學生範例 其他範例 專題範例

學習資料庫的心得

欄目: 學習心得體會 / 釋出於: / 人氣:2.82W

轉眼間在從大一踏進學校的校門到現在剛剛好一年了,在這一年中,資料庫也如影隨形。

學習資料庫的心得

在這一年中我主要學習的資料庫是sql serverXX,在學習的時候過程中,我們首先是從基礎開始,比如資料型別、運算子號、關鍵字等等,然後上升到一些增刪改查,還有觸發、儲存過程等的使用等等。

經過了一學期的學習,我從起初對資料庫的認識模糊到後來清晰,深入,我認為我學到了許許多多的東西。當然,在學習中,薛立柱會給我們在網上下很多的學習資料,同時他也會建議我們多讀讀網上的學習資料。除了這個以外,我在學習資料庫課程過程中,接觸到的軟體工程思想,網上學習經驗,以及利用網路的學習資源都很好的改善了我的學習。後來,在學習的深入中,雖然學習有時是十分叫人感到枯燥乏味的,但我慶幸的是我堅持了下來,在最後的考試複習中,薛立柱老師雖然勸誡我學習不要因為考試而停止。是啊!要想學好一門功課我們需要的是持之以恆的精神。

資料庫程式設計,這個是作為一個程式設計師的基本功,絕大多數軟體開發公司資料庫程式設計都是由程式設計師自己完成的,因為他的工作量不是很大,也不是很複雜。所以作為一個綜合的程式設計師,學習資料庫程式設計,像資料庫四大操作,增刪改查,還有觸發、儲存過程等的使用,這些都是基礎的基礎。很多時候我們會認為資料庫沒什麼作用,學習的時候吊兒郎當,到今年做專案時,還不會連線查詢,要想避免這種情況發生就必須打好基礎,紮實的掌握每個知識點。

只要你從事計算機行業,就需要學習好資料庫的基礎知識,不論以後選擇哪個方向,資料庫的學習都不能放鬆。古人云:書到用時方恨少,知識學多了不會成為累贅,慢慢的積累,總有用到的時候。給自己明確一個目標,剩下的就是向著這個目標努力,無論遇到什麼困難,克服它就向成功邁進了一步。

學習資料庫的心得(2):

一:學習心得

經過一個學期的資料庫課程的學習,我們掌握了建立資料庫以及對資料庫的操作的基礎知識。資料庫這門課涉及到以前的知識不多,是一門從頭學起的課程,即使基礎不是很好,只要認真聽講、複習功課,還是一門比較容易掌握的課。

課堂上講的知識比較理論化,如果不動手就無法將知識轉化為技能,而動手去做能夠讓我們將學過的知識在實踐中運用,找到知識漏洞,並且能學到更多關於實際操作的知識和技巧。並且培養了我們的自學能力。

第一次接觸sql語言,雖然陌生,但是可以讓我從頭開始學,就算沒有基礎的人也可以學得很好。剛開始練習sql語言的時候,並不是很難,基本上都是按照老師的步驟來做,還很有成就感。我們通過老師的一些ppt,我們可以鞏固課內的知識,還可以學習內容相關的知識,更好地完成老師佈置的作業。

二、access與excel的區別

access--中小型資料庫開發系統,內嵌vba程式語言,面向物件程式設計

excel--資料表格處理系統,程式設計能力有限.

access是資料庫管理軟體,內含的是資料庫(基本物件),一個數據庫包含多張表 主要用於開發系統 ,日常辦公用起來不方便,他主要是做軟體的後臺的。

而excel只是一般的表格處理軟體,主要用於一些日常的辦公而已

兩都所用到的地方不一樣.

access是一個數據庫軟體,一個access檔案由儲存特定結構化資料集的表集合組成。表中包含行(有時稱作記錄或元組)和列(有時稱作特性)的集合。表中的每一列都設計為儲存某種型別的資訊(例如,日期、名稱、美元金額或數字)。表上有幾種控制(約束、規則、觸發器、預設值和自定義使用者資料型別)用於確保資料的有效性。表上可以有索引(與書中的索引非常相似),利用索引可以快速地找到行。可將宣告引用完整性 (dri) 約束新增到表上,以確保不同表中相互關聯的資料保持一致。

而excel是一個電子表格製作軟體,其表格可以進行排序、計算等操作.

從我個人理解,在電腦同樣的配置的情況下excel在處理大量資料的速度遠遠落後與access,在資料配比上access在效能上更高於excel,

三、學習資料庫的收穫

sql (結構化查詢語言)是用於執行查詢的語法。但是 sql 語言也包含用於更新、插入和刪除記錄的語法。

查詢和更新指令構成了 sql 的 dml 部分:

select - 從資料庫表中獲取資料

update - 更新資料庫表中的資料

delete - 從資料庫表中刪除資料

insert into - 向資料庫表中插入資料

sql 的資料定義語言 (ddl) 部分使我們有能力建立或刪除表格。我們也可以定義索引(鍵),規定表之間的連結,以及施加表間的約束。

sql 中最重要的 ddl 語句:

create database - 建立新資料庫

alter database - 修改資料庫

create table - 建立新表

alter table - 變更(改變)資料庫表

drop table - 刪除表

create index - 建立索引(搜尋鍵)

drop index - 刪除索引

資料庫有保持資料的獨立性,所謂資料獨立,是指儲存在資料庫中的資料獨立於處理資料的所有應用程式而存在。也就是說,資料是客觀實體的符號化標識,它就是一個客觀存在,不會因為某一項應用的需要而改變它的結構,因此是獨立於應用而存在著的客觀實體。而某一項應用是處理資料獲取資訊的過程,也就是應用程式,它只能根據客觀存在著的資料來設計所需要的資料處理方法,而不會去改變客觀存在著的資料本身。資料庫的傳統定義是以一定的組織方式儲存的一組相關資料的集合,主要表現為資料表的集合。

根據標準,sql語句按其功能的不同可以分為以下6大類:

資料定義語句(data-definition language,ddl);

資料操作語句(data-manipulation languagesql serverXX 功能,dml);

操作管理語句(transaction-management language,tml);

資料控制語句(data-control language,dcl);

資料查詢語句(data-query language,dql);

遊標控制語句(cursor-control language,ccl)。

這門課中仍然有許多不太懂的地方,還需要以後進一步學習。

Tags:資料庫 學習